Jules C Benbow 1925 - 2004

Jules C Benbow of Huachuca City, Cochise County, AZ was born on May 27, 1925, and died at age 79 years old on December 22, 2004. Jules Benbow was buried at Southern Arizona Veterans Memorial Cemetery Section 2P Row 5 Site 5 1300 Buffalo Soldier Trail, in Sierra Vista.

Did you know?
In 1925, in the year that Jules C Benbow was born, on November 28th, radio station WSM broadcast the Grand Ole Opry for the first time. Originally airing as “The WSM Barn Dance”, the Opry (a local term for "opera") was dedicated to honoring country music and in its history has featured the biggest stars and acts in country music.
Did you know?
In 1951, Jules was 26 years old when on April 5th, Julius and Ethel Rosenberg (husband and wife) were sentenced to death for treason. They were executed on June 19th. American citizens, they were convicted of spying for the Soviet Union. Their two young sons were adopted by a high school teacher and his wife.
